Polartechnics EGM to proceed despite Opara's request to postpone
Thursday, 11 August, 2005
A Polartechnics (ASX:PLT) extraordinary general meeting (EGM) requisitioned by the company's former interim chairman Richard Opara will be held in Sydney this Friday, despite the company receiving a letter from him on August 8 proposing to postpone the meeting.
In June, Opara served a requisition on Polartechnics to convene an EGM, proposing that Polartechnics CEO Victor Skladnev and Robert Hunter be removed as directors and Opara and Leonard Firestone be appointed instead.
Polartechnics has received legal advice to the effect that the EGM cannot be postponed on Opara's proposal and that the statement in Opara's letter that said "Dr Len Firestone and I withdraw our board nominations" is not an effective withdrawal of the requisitioned resolutions.
